OverviewJustine Poole takes her job as a security agent seriously. When she prevents a brazen theft at the Beverly Hills home of two of her clients - killing two of the five armed robbers in the process - she is initially lauded in the media as a local hero. But the spotlight soon puts her in the crosshairs of the crime kingpin behind the burglaries. So begins a cat and mouse game featuring two characters who know more about deadly pursuit than anyone else in the business. As the hardened killer stalks her, Justine finds that public opinion can be every bit as fatal as organized crime...
